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on today condemned the use of force to settle differences in Guinea-Bissau and called for the respect of the lawful civilian authorities in the West African country.
Media reports indicated that Guinea-Bissau’s navy commander has been arrested after disturbances yesterday, which some of the country’s senior officials described as a coup attempt. The reports quoted the army as saying there were more clashes in the capital, Bissau, overnight.
